Mary E. Ledain
Ontario: Entered into rest on (Sunday) November 7, 2021 at age 86.
Predeceased by her husband: Donald J. Ledain, Sr.; son: Donald J. Ledain, Jr.
Mary was a wonderful homemaker who enjoyed babysitting, knitting, sewing, and traveling in their motorhome. Most importantly, spending time with her family warmed her heart.
Survived by her loving and devoted daughter: Dawn (Kendolph) Thomas; daughter in law: Heather Ledain; grandchildren: Michael (Korryn) and Ryan Deichmiller, and Kristopher Thomas, Ben and Alex Ledain; great grandchildren: Charleigh, Lylah, and Elyse; sister: Barbara (Robert) Canan; brothers: Lester (Carol) and Dennis Gillespie; sister in law: Patti Ledain; many extended family members and friends.
